Edgewater Condominium
The Edgewater Condominium, a six-story brick structure completed in 1958, stands as a testament to mid-century design in Downtown Stamford. This 66-unit complex offers residents a blend of historical character and modern urban living. Situated in a vibrant neighborhood, the Edgewater provides easy access to the city's diverse amenities while maintaining a sense of community within its walls. The building's enduring presence in Stamford's evolving cityscape speaks to its timeless appeal and strategic location.

Located about an hour’s drive northeast of New York City, Stamford’s downtown area provides residents with shopping, entertainment, and dining on a much smaller, more intimate scale than the Big Apple. As the heart of Stamford, Downtown Stamford is packed with trendy restaurants, theaters, bars, and live music venues. Downtown also remains lively with multiple events held here throughout the year including Stamford Downtown Farmers Markets, Arts & Crafts on Bedford, and Art Collective. If locals aren’t exploring local businesses, you might find them at a nearby greenspace like Mill River Park and there are several beaches just three miles away. The neighborhood is similar to other city centers. Downtown Stamford features luxury lofts and apartments available for rent, but there are also houses and townhomes available at moderately priced rates.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ources
